Transaction 31b0cf59c1aca4ca0371000e38c4b0a6986f2dc374a7f9af5cb5c58af5766fe5
1 Input
2 Outputs
- 31b0cf59c1aca4ca0371000e38c4b0a6986f2dc374a7f9af5cb5c58af5766fe5:0
- 31b0cf59c1aca4ca0371000e38c4b0a6986f2dc374a7f9af5cb5c58af5766fe5:1
value 25000000
address 12xKLiXVJmfCm37LcEHSdRr1bvChUSFWew
value 25262880
address 1BiyB6wu3i5PfWyhRWa5r26y54nZV6VWGJ